An MRI technician moves his hand from a region of very low magnetic field strength into an MRI scanner’s 2.00 T field with his fingers pointing in the direction of the field. His wedding ring has a diameter of 2.35 cm and it takes 0.475 s to move it into the field

a. What average current is induced in the ring in A if its resistance is 0.0100 Ω?

b. What average power is dissipated in mW?

c. What magnetic field is induced at the center of the ring in T?
